运行代码创建数据库表(实例一)
来源:互联网 发布:java培训机构多少钱 编辑:程序博客网 时间:2024/05/17 16:02
User.java
package com.entel.research;import java.util.Date;public class User{private String id;private String name;private String password;private Date createTime;private Date expireTime;public String getId(){return id;}public void setId(String id){this.id = id;}public String getName(){return name;}public void setName(String name){this.name = name;}public String getPassword(){return password;}public void setPassword(String password){this.password = password;}public Date getCreateTime(){return createTime;}public void setCreateTime(Date createTime){this.createTime = createTime;}public Date getExpireTime(){return expireTime;}public void setExpireTime(Date expireTime){this.expireTime = expireTime;}}
User.hbm.xml
<?xml version="1.0"?><!DOCTYPE hibernate-mapping PUBLIC "-//Hibernate/Hibernate Mapping DTD 3.0//EN""http://hibernate.sourceforge.net/hibernate-mapping-3.0.dtd"><hibernate-mapping><class name="com.entel.research.User"><id name="id"><generator class="uuid" /></id><property name="name" /><property name="password" /><property name="createTime" /><property name="expireTime" /></class></hibernate-mapping>
hibernate.cfg.xml
<!DOCTYPE hibernate-configuration PUBLIC"-//Hibernate/Hibernate Configuration DTD 3.0//EN""http://hibernate.sourceforge.net/hibernate-configuration-3.0.dtd"><hibernate-configuration><session-factory><property name="hibernate.connection.url">jdbc:mysql://localhost/hibernate_first</property><property name="hibernate.connection.driver_class">com.mysql.jdbc.Driver</property><property name="hibernate.connection.username">root</property><property name="hibernate.connection.password">root</property><property name="hibernate.dialect">org.hibernate.dialect.MySQLDialect</property><property name="hibernate.show_sql">true</property><mapping resource="com/entel/research/User.hbm.xml" /></session-factory></hibernate-configuration>
ExportDB.java
package com.entel.research;import org.hibernate.cfg.Configuration;import org.hibernate.tool.hbm2ddl.SchemaExport;public class ExportDB{public static void main(String[] args){// 读取hibernate.cfg.xml文件Configuration cfg = new Configuration().configure();SchemaExport export = new SchemaExport(cfg);export.create(true, true);}}
- 运行代码创建数据库表(实例一)
- db2 创建实例,创建数据库,创建表
- 创建数据库、创建表实例 08.11.6
- java代码创建数据库表
- 代码进行时--创建数据库,创建表
- Spring.net实例[创建数据库和项目](一)
- 一、创建数据库及创建表
- PHP创建数据库与表实例
- oracle数据库表,索引创建实例
- 动态创建数据库实例
- 动态创建数据库实例
- ORACEL11GR2 创建数据库实例
- 创建数据库实例
- oracle 创建数据库实例
- oracle11g创建数据库实例
- Oracle数据库创建实例
- DBCA创建数据库实例
- (一)创建store实例
- http://blog.csdn.net/laiboy
- 01 java 编程基础
- mysql重设root密码
- 段选择符和段寄存器
- 用ant编译时,遇到 要了解详细信息,请使用 -Xlint:unchecked 重新编译。
- 运行代码创建数据库表(实例一)
- curl 简单作
- 骆驼命名法,帕斯卡命名法和匈牙利命名法
- Oracle VM VirtualBox 虚拟机设置全屏与共享
- mysql数据库常用命令
- MSSQL 2005 复制本地数据库到本地
- windows消息机制
- 表驱动法
- 持久化一个对象(实例一)